The Role

We have an immediate opportunity for a Structural Forensic Vice President with interests in structural forensic investigation, litigation support, risk loss consulting, structural repair, and retrofit design. This individual will be expected to execute structural investigations of existing buildings and design remedial repairs for deficient conditions. The investigations include failure cause and origin analysis, life cycle cost and feasibility analyses, risk loss insurance, and claims response, and litigation support. The candidate will be required to provide direction to, and review the work product of, junior-level staff, coordinate with other project managers on interdisciplinary efforts, support marketing efforts, and develop and maintain client relationships.

About Thornton Tomasetti

Thornton Tomasetti is an engineering and design firm that provides a wide range of services to clients in the construction industry. The company's services include structural engineering, façade engineering, sustainability consulting, and more. Thornton Tomasetti is committed to providing innovative solutions to complex engineering challenges, and has worked on some of the world's most iconic buildings. The company was founded in 1956 and is based in New York, NY.
